541,554 is a composite number, even.
541,554 (five hundred forty-one thousand five hundred fifty-four) is an even 6-digit number. It is a composite number with 32 divisors, and factors as 2 × 3 × 13 × 53 × 131. Its proper divisors sum to 655,950, more than the number itself, making it an abundant number. Written other ways, in hexadecimal, 0x84372.
